What is Lead Forensics?

Lead Forensics by Lead Forensics is a powerful web analytics tool designed to identify anonymous website visitors and turn them into actionable sales leads. It provides businesses with detailed information about the companies visiting their website, including contact details and browsing behavior. This technology is widely used by sales and marketing teams across various industries to improve lead generation, target potential customers, and enhance sales effectiveness.
